Depending on what you need, you can alternate between scopes to compensate for the distance. Different scopes can help you with varying distances of engagement. Where increased range means you can view targets much further away with better clarity, increased precision means you can have more confidence in your ability to shoot at that distance. While this goes in tandem with increased range, it is slightly different. The right scope delivers clarity at long distances so that you know precisely where your target is without error in judgement.

The main reason for using any scope is to increase your view distance. Not using a scope can have its benefits in certain situations, such as when you need to engage in close quarters, but when you do find yourself shooting at range, you will be happy you have a scope for the following reasons:
